      I have to move.It's time to shed some non-essential items such as 5 air rifles. It would help to know what value they might have. As best I can tell ,I have a Sheridan "Blue Streak w/Walnut stock and pumphandle [12 rings]. The safety is a hinged metal ear that can be depressed to the "on" position once the cocking arm has retracted the "bolt". It has a brass barrel and air chamber. The "blueing is quite well worn. Ser.# is H112294. Next is a Daisy Mod. 25,made in Plymouth MI, Register # K022102,stamped "engraving " w/o paint added to it,plastic stock and 12 ring cocking handle. 3rd is a Crosman V-350 w/ palletwood stock,front sight missing ,rear sight broken, bluing -good except worn in slide area. Last is a pair of Daist Mod. 111s,both with plastic stocks,one with a Puma head on each side of the receiver area plus fake engraving. It has a barrel band. I'm not sure if this is the proper place to ask but I couldn't find any other. If anyone can assist me It would be nice. Ken
